WebMay 11, 2024 · The zodiac, literally the circle of animals, is constituted by the 12 stellar constellations through which the Sun appears to pass in its annual movement through the heavens. The 12 constellations form a belt across the night sky some 8 to 9 degrees on either side of the solar orbit. WebThe planets, the Sun, and the Moon are thus always found in the sky within a narrow 18-degree-wide belt, centered on the ecliptic, called the zodiac . (The root of the term “zodiac” is the same as that of the word “zoo” and means a collection of animals; many of the patterns of stars within the zodiac belt reminded the ancients of ... WebThe day can be measured either by the stars or by the Sun. If the stars are used, then the interval is called the sidereal day and is defined by the period between two passages of a star (more precisely of the vernal equinox, a reference point on the celestial sphere) across the meridian: it is 23 hours 56 minutes 4.10 seconds of mean solar time. WebThe zodiac stretches about 8-9 degrees either side of the ecliptic, and is the region of the sky where we can find the Sun, Moon and planets (except for Pluto). The zodiac is narrow because most of the planets have orbits that are only slightly inclined to that of the Earth.

WebThe word zodiac comes from the Greek ζῳδιακός (zōidiakos), meaning the “circle of animals.”. The Latin term zōdiacus was derived from the Greek, and the Greek term comes from the word ζῴδιον (zōdion), which is the diminutive of ζῷον (zōon), or animal.
